If you receive the message "QuickBooks Company File Not Found," it signifies that the programme was unable to find the requested company file for opening or access. This problem may arise for a number of reasons, including incorrect file path settings, network connectivity issues, inadvertent file deletion or relocation, and file corruption. Major Reasons That Are Known to Trigger ‘Company File Not Found in QB Desktop’
Error
You can encounter the ‘Company File Not Found in QB Desktop’ error due to the
reasons listed here:
• If the hard drive has some internal problems or if the name of the company file
is not correct, then this issue can arise in the system.
• Major defects in the company file data and connectivity problems can also
cause this error on the computer.
What Are the Appropriate Resolutions for the ‘QB
Desktop Company File Cannot Be Located’ Error?
You can tackle the ‘QB Desktop Company File Cannot Be Located’ error by using
the step-wise resolutions stated here:
Resolution 1: Perform a complete search for the relevant
company files and then note the file’s location on the
computer
• First & foremost, easily access the ‘Start’ menu shown on the Windows
Desktop and then type the following names of the relevant files as shown
below:
Extension of the Relevant File Name of the
Relevant File
*qbw Company File
*qbb Backup Company File
*qbx Accountants Transfer
File
*qby Accountants Change
File
*qba Accountants Copy
File
• After discovering the relevant file, you must note its current location,
following which you can proceed forward to the next resolution given below.
Resolution 2: Follow the precise step-wise process to access
the desired company file on the computer
Depending upon the type of company file that you want to access, you can follow
the steps described below:
Step A: Accessing the Company File or the Accountant Copy File
• Instantly go to the ‘File’ menu inside the QB Desktop application & then choose
the ‘Open or Restore Company’ tab, after which you can select the desired
company file through the ‘Open a Company File’ option.
• Next, strike the ‘Open’ button to finally launch the desired file on your system.
Step B: Properly restore the Backup Company File on the computer
• Easily choose the ‘Open or Restore Company’ tab under the ‘File’ menu, and then
you can strike the ‘Restore a backup file’ tab, after which you can successfully
find the backup file via the ‘Local Backup’ option.
• Thereafter, once you have selected the backup file, you can hit the ‘Save’ button
to properly save the backup company file on the system.
Step C: Successfully restore the Accountant Transfer File
• Here, just choose the ‘Open or Restore Company’ tab provided under the ‘File’
menu and then simply strike the ‘Convert an Accountant Transfer File’ button on
the window.
• Thereafter, successfully choose the Accountant Transfer File, following which you
can hit the ‘Open’ button on the screen.
